Transaction ebc5a89f3f590c8bc4551ef3865d177dc285eb3f597cbb89db9b0f251cd03b97
1 Input
1 Output
-
ebc5a89f3f590c8bc4551ef3865d177dc285eb3f597cbb89db9b0f251cd03b97:0
- value
- 78678397
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ad9485b40668421d46d574c9887e25668c6080
- address
- bc1quzkefpd5qe5yy82x646vnzr7y4ngccyq7uvn49